Amputation Balance Prosthesis Clinical Trial
Official title:
The Effect of Alternative Prosthetic Alignments on Sit-to-Stand Proficiency in Transtibial Amputees
The purpose of this graduate student research study is to determine the effect of various linear and angular prosthetic alignments on K1-K3 unilateral or bilateral TT amputees, as well as test for proficiency, comfort, balance, heart rate and fit during sit to stands.
Initial Visit: 1. Informed consent 2. HIPAA 3. Foot Inspection 4. Review expectations 5. Take measurements 6. Casting Second Visit: Fitting and adjusting accordingly. - One person will conduct all the measurements, casting, check sockets, etc. to evade inconsistencies in data collection. - Begin conducting practice runs on Balance Master at LLU-East Campus. Third, Fourth and Fifth Visit: Testing (5-10-minute rest period in between each test) *Testing will be video recorded for re-assessment of subjects* 1. Five times sit-to-stand test (5XSTS). 2. Activities-Specific Balance Confidence (ABC-16) scale 3. Balance Master: Weight Bearing Squat (WBS) Unilateral Stance (US) Sensory Organization Test (SOT) modified Clinical Test of Sensory Interaction on Balance (mCTSIB) Limits of Stability (LOS) 4. A Polar H10 heart rate monitor will be worn while subjects perform each of the various tests. ;
